Both manual and automatic transmissions are available. Here is the relevant introduction: 1. Pickup Truck: A transliteration of the American term, also known as a car-truck, as the name suggests, it is both a car and a truck. It is a light-duty cargo vehicle with an open cargo box behind the cab, where the side panels of the cargo box are integrated with the cab. It is a dual-purpose passenger and cargo vehicle that resembles a sedan in the front and has a cargo box at the back. 2. Introduction: Pickup trucks are an important part of the automotive market. A pickup (pick-up) is a vehicle that adopts the front end and cab of a sedan while featuring an open cargo compartment. Its characteristics include the comfort of a sedan, strong power, and even greater cargo capacity and adaptability to rough roads compared to sedans. The most common type of pickup truck is the double-cab pickup. Pickup trucks can serve as special-purpose vehicles, multi-purpose vehicles, official vehicles, commercial vehicles, or family cars, used for cargo transport, travel, rental, etc. The so-called "pickup" is a hybrid of a sedan and a truck.
